About This Role:

Leads the enterprise Supplier Development & Readiness function with direct accountability for supplier capability improvement, operational readiness, recovery execution, and capacity validation. This role ensures suppliers are capable, resilient, and prepared to meet current and future business needs. The Sr. Manager owns the supplier transformation operating model, oversees readiness for new programs and volume ramps, and leads recovery for at‑risk or strategically important suppliers.

Job Description:

Supplier Development & Recovery Leadership
  • Lead and prioritize Supplier Development engagements for critical, strategic, and at‑risk suppliers, ensuring rapid stabilization and capability uplift.
  • Validate real vs. stated capacity, production allocation, staffing, tooling, and process capability.
  • Drive and oversee structured root cause analysis (RCA) and ensure disciplined execution of recovery and improvement plans.
  • Govern readiness milestones and exit criteria for supplier transitions back to stable execution.
Capability Building & Transformation
  • Oversee on‑site execution of capacity expansion, process improvements, throughput optimization, and cycle‑time reduction initiatives.
  • Champion operational excellence using Lean, Six Sigma, and advanced manufacturing practices across the supply base.
  • Enable and support dual sourcing, localization, footprint shifts, and lead‑time reduction strategies.
  • Ensure suppliers develop sustainable systems, standard work, and controls that prevent recurrence of issues.
Strategic Readiness & Growth Enablement
  • Define readiness criteria and governance for supplier readiness across:
  • New product introductions (NPI)
  • Technology transitions
  • Volume ramps and SIOP‑driven growth cycles
  • Partner with SIOP, Strategic Sourcing, Engineering, Quality, and Supplier Capacity/Performance teams to align readiness actions with supply strategy and demand signals.
Cross‑Functional Influence & Alignment
  • Act as the enterprise escalation owner for critical supplier readiness risks.
  • Influence sourcing strategies, capital investment decisions, and supplier selection through readiness insights.
  • Represent Supplier Development & Readiness in executive reviews, risk forums, and program governance meetings.
  • Ensure alignment between Supplier Development activities and the Supplier Capacity & Performance organization for end‑to‑end supplier health.
Leadership & Influence
  • Lead, coach, and develop Supplier Development Engineers.
  • Build technical and leadership capability in root cause analysis, process optimization, change management, and capability assessment.
  • Foster a culture of accountability, hands‑on engagement, and fact‑based decision‑making.
Required Qualifications:
  • Bachelors degree
  • 8+ years of experience in Supplier Development, Manufacturing, Operations, Supplier Quality, or Industrial/Manufacturing Engineering
  • 5+ years of experience conducting capacity audits, operational readiness assessments, and hands‑on process improvement
  • 5+ years of experience in people leadership
  • Ability to travel up to 25% of the time
Preferred Qualifications:
  • Proven track record leading suppliers through transformational change and crisis stabilization
  • Comfortable working on‑site at suppliers, including hands‑on shop‑floor engagement.
  • Engineering degree preferred (Industrial, Manufacturing, Mechanical, or Systems)
  • Experience with Lean, Six Sigma, PFMEA, and Operations Excellence tools is an advantage
